Dr. Kailey Bradley (she/her/hers) is a licensed counselor with a doctorate in counselor education and supervision from Ohio University (2024). She is certified in thanatology (FT) and has extensive training in grief counseling and end-of-life care. Dr. Bradley has experience in hospice settings and supports clients with end-of-life decision-making. She is passionate about working with children and families facing grief and illness and currently serves as president of the Association for Child and Adolescent Counseling Ohio Branch. In addition, Dr. Bradley is an adjunct professor in the thanatology program at Marian University, where she teaches courses on childhood bereavement, pediatric hospice care, and expressive arts in counseling.
